The most interesting colleges globally

Hi there! I'm an American high school student, but I've always been intrigued by the idea of studying in a different country. I was wondering, what are some of the most interesting or unique colleges anywhere in the world? Really appreciate any suggestions.

2 years ago

Sure, there are many remarkable universities around the world worth considering! Each university has its own unique qualities that sets them apart. I'll mention a few:

1. University of Oxford (England): This university is one of the oldest and most prestigious in the world. It boasts a collegiate system where students become part of smaller, individual colleges within the university, facilitating a closely-knit and dynamic community.

2. McGill University (Canada): Known for its vibrant urban campus in the heart of multicultural Montreal, McGill offers a wide variety of disciplines and has a strong international student presence.

3. University of Tokyo (Japan): As Japan's highest-ranked university, it offers a unique experience blending traditional and modern culture in the heart of one of the world's busiest cities.

4. University of Melbourne (Australia): Situated in one of the most livable cities in the world, Melbourne University offers an innovative curriculum where undergraduates first take generalist degrees before specializing at postgraduate level.

5. University of Cape Town (South Africa): Nestled at the base of Table Mountain, it combines rigorous academics with a beautiful setting and rich history. It's renowned for its school of African and Gender Studies.

6. Universidad Nacional Autónoma de México (Mexico): This university offers a rich cultural experience as it's located in the heart of Mexico City. It's extensively implicated in the country's history and culture while offering modern and state-of-the art facilities.

While I could go on enumerating plenty of other unique universities, it's critical that you research and ascertain which university aligns with your academic and personal interests. Consider factors like language of instruction, academic programs, living costs, climate, cultural factors and more as these aspects will have a significant influence on your university experience abroad.
